DANGEROUS GOODS (GENERAL) REGULATIONS - REGULATION 81

Application for licence to manufacture or store corrosive substances

(1) Every application, pursuant to any of the provisions of section 6 of the
Ordinance, for any licence to manufacture or store any dangerous  goods shall
be made in writing addressed to the Authority and, in the case of any
application for a licence to store any such goods, shall be accompanied by 2
copies of a plan, as nearly as may be to scale, of the store, and every such
plan shall include the following particulars-

   (a)  the siting of the store;

   (b)  the material of which it is or is to be constructed; and

   (c)  such other particulars, if any, as the Authority may require to be
        shown on the plan.

(2) Every plan submitted pursuant to the provisions of paragraph

(1) shall be accompanied by a statement in writing declaring the nature and
maximum quantity of the corrosive substance or substances in respect of which
the licence is required.

(3) Every plan submitted pursuant to the provisions of paragraph

(1), or any modification thereof, which is approved by the Authority shall be
endorsed to that effect and one copy shall be returned to the applicant and
one retained by the Authority.
